Leadership
We’ve been a family-owned and operated business since our humble beginnings in 1993. Over the years, we’ve come to understand how the commitment and cohesiveness of a family helps improve the home building experience.
Spanning two generations, we’re proud of our work and, most importantly, our unwavering commitment to our clients. Our dedication to clients — whether it’s searching for a custom product or ensuring every detail meets our strict quality guidelines — is what sets us apart.

Eric Payne
President
Eric was the third person to join the Payne and Payne team full time in 1995! Prior to that, he worked in the trades doing hands on construction. As acting President, Eric has intimate knowledge of all aspects of building a custom home including experience in framing, siding, electrical, roofing, trim work, painting, sales, design, and project management. Eric enjoys continuing education in building science and always makes himself available to help on projects.
He lives in Chardon with his wife Lia, and daughters Sierra and Mikala. In his free time, he can be found playing volleyball, skiing, hiking, hunting, traveling, and motorcycle riding.

Justen Musick
Project Manager
BS Engineering Technology, Kent State University
Associates Degree in Drafting and Design
LEED AP
OSHA 30
Justen joined the Payne and Payne team in 2016 after working for a large construction company where he specialized in historical rehabs and repurposing of historically significant buildings. Justen also has experience in civil design; including grading, site balances, utility planning, environmental compliance, storm water management, 3D modeling sites and custom management structures and roadway design. He has worked on geotechnical crews taking soil/rock borings, ran the Trimble robotic total station for field surveys, ran ground penetrating equipment, and performed environmental testing for groundwater monitoring.

Darrell Hershey
Project Manager
BS Business Administration Malone University
Darrell has spent his entire career in the construction field. He spent his summers during college working as a laborer and carpenter. As a new graduate, Darrell began working as an estimator for a building supply company, and as a field supervisor for residential construction and remodeling.
At P&P he is one of our Project Managers. Darrell is tasked with being the link between the office and the field. He specifies our homes, estimates them, sets the preconstruction schedule, and works with the field supervisor to coordinate communication and changes during the build.
